Sizing a boiler for this county starts with understanding what the equipment is genuinely asked to carry each year. Homes in Saratoga County, NY run heat about nine months a year, from September through May. A burner and heat exchanger that cycle through that much of the calendar accumulate wear in proportion, and a unit that was undersized or sloppily commissioned will show it in the ignition system, the seals, and the heat exchanger long before a well-matched install would. A contractor quoting a replacement here has to work out the right output for the house first, because an install that is off in either direction costs the homeowner in repairs before the warranty conversation is even relevant.

Ductwork laid down for an earlier generation of equipment carries assumptions about airflow, volume, and heat distribution that a new boiler may not share. Half the homes in Saratoga County, New York were built in 1984 or earlier (2020-2024 ACS 5-year). A contractor quoting a boiler installation here has to establish what the existing distribution system was built for before the equipment choice matters much. Runs that were sized for a different load, or modified more than once over the decades, can force a redesign that the unit price never reflected.

What a Boiler Installation Puts in Your Home

Isometric cutaway illustration of a single-storey house showing a boiler with a flue pipe, orange pipework running to wall-mounted radiators in several rooms furnished with a sofa, table and beds.

The boiler itself sits in the basement or a mechanical room and is the heart of the system. A contractor installs the unit there along with an expansion tank, which absorbs pressure changes in the water as it heats and cools. Together these two pieces form the core of what a new installation places in the home.

From the boiler, supply and return pipes run through the house to the heat emitters, whether those are radiators, baseboard units, or radiant floor loops set into the subfloor. A circulator pump, mounted close to the boiler, moves the heated water through that circuit. A pressure relief valve and a backflow preventer are also fitted at the boiler to protect the system and the home's water supply.
